++ trunk/HISTORY	(local)
$Id: HISTORY,v 1.1632 2007/09/11 21:46:35 debug Exp $
20070616	Implementing the MIPS32/64 revision 2 "ror" instruction.
20070617	Adding a struct for each physpage which keeps track of which
		ranges within that page (base offset, length) that are
		continuously translatable. When running with native code
		generation enabled (-b), a range is added after each read-
		ahead loop.
		Experimenting with using the physical program counter sample
		data (implemented 20070608) together with the "translatable
		range" information, to figure out which physical address ranges
		would be worth translating to native code (if the number of
		samples falling within a range is above a certain threshold).
20070618	Adding automagic building of .index comment files for
		src/file/, src/promemul/, src src/useremul/ as well.
		Adding a "has been translated" bit to the ranges, so that only
		not-yet-translated ranges will be sampled.
20070619	Moving src/cpu.c and src/memory_rw.c into src/cpus/,
		src/device.c into src/devices/, and src/machine.c into
		src/machines/.
		Creating a skeleton cc/ld native backend module; beginning on
		the function which will detect cc command line, etc.
20070620	Continuing on the native code generation infrastructure.
20070621	Moving src/x11.c and src/console.c into a new src/console/
		subdir (for everything that is console or framebuffer related).
		Moving src/symbol*.c into a new src/symbol/, which should
		contain anything that is symbol handling related.
20070624	Making the program counter sampling threshold a "settings
		variable" (sampling_threshold), i.e. it can now be changed
		during runtime.
		Switching the RELEASE notes format from plain text to HTML.
		If the TMPDIR environment variable is set, it is used instead
		of "/tmp" for temporary files.
		Continuing on the cc/ld backend: simple .c code is generated,
		the compiler and linker are called, etc.
		Adding detection of host architecture to the configure script
		(again), and adding icache invalidation support (only
		implemented for Alpha hosts so far).
20070625	Simplifying the program counter sampling mechanism.
20070626	Removing the cc/ld native code generation stuff, program
		counter sampling, etc; it would not have worked well in the
		general case.
20070627	Removing everything related to native code generation.
20070629	Removing the (practically unusable) support for multiple
		emulations. (The single emulation allowed now still supports
		multiple simultaneous machines, as before.)
		Beginning on PCCTWO and M88K interrupts.
20070723	Adding a dummy skeleton for emulation of M32R processors.
20070901	Fixing a warning found by "gcc version 4.3.0 20070817
		(experimental)" on amd64.
20070905	Removing some more traces of the old "multiple emulations"
		code.
		Also looking in /usr/local/include and /usr/local/lib for
		X11 libs, when running configure.
20070909	Minor updates to the guest OS install instructions, in
		preparation for the NetBSD 4.0 release.
20070918	More testing of NetBSD 4.0 RC1.

28 * $Id: dreamcast.c,v 1.17 2007/06/17 23:32:20 debug Exp $
29 *
30 * COMMENT: Dreamcast PROM emulation
31 *
32 * NOTE: This is basically just a dummy module, for now.
33 *
34 * See http://mc.pp.se/dc/syscalls.html for a description of what the
35 * PROM syscalls do. (The symbolic names in this module are the same as on
36 * that page.)
37 */

49
50 /* The ROM FONT seems to be located just after 1MB, in a real Dreamcast: */
51 #define DREAMCAST_ROMFONT_BASE 0x80100020
52
53 static int booting_from_cdrom = 0;
54
55
56 /*
57 * dreamcast_romfont_init()
58 *
59 * Initialize the ROM font.
60 */
61 static void dreamcast_romfont_init(struct machine *machine)
62 {
63 struct cpu *cpu = machine->cpus[0];
64 int i, y, v;
65 uint64_t d = DREAMCAST_ROMFONT_BASE;
66
67 /* TODO: A real font. */
68
69 /* 288 narrow glyphs (12 x 24 pixels): */
70 for (i=0; i<288; i++) {
71 for (y=0; y<24; y+=2) {
72 if (y <= 1 || y >= 22)
73 v = 0;
74 else
75 v = random();
76 store_byte(cpu, d++, v & 0x3f);
77 store_byte(cpu, d++, v & 0xc3);
78 store_byte(cpu, d++, v & 0xfc);
79 }
80 }
81
82 /* 7078 wide glyphs (24 x 24 pixels): */
83 for (i=0; i<7078; i++) {
84 for (y=0; y<24; y++) {
85 if (y <= 1 || y >= 22)
86 v = 0;
87 else
88 v = random();
89 store_byte(cpu, d++, v & 0x3f);
90 store_byte(cpu, d++, v);
91 store_byte(cpu, d++, v & 0xfc);
92 }
93 }
94
95 /* 129 VME icons (32 x 32 pixels): */
96 for (i=0; i<129; i++) {
97 for (y=0; y<32; y++) {
98 if (y <= 1 || y >= 30)
99 v = 0;
100 else
101 v = random();
102 store_byte(cpu, d++, v & 0x3f);
103 store_byte(cpu, d++, v);
104 store_byte(cpu, d++, v);
105 store_byte(cpu, d++, v & 0xfc);
106 }
107 }
108 }
109
110
111 /*
112 * dreamcast_machine_setup():
113 *
114 * Initializes pointers to Dreamcast PROM syscalls.
115 */
116 void dreamcast_machine_setup(struct machine *machine)
117 {
118 int i;
119 struct cpu *cpu = machine->cpus[0];
120
121 for (i=0; i<0x50; i+=sizeof(uint32_t)) {
122 /* Store pointer to PROM routine... */
123 store_32bit_word(cpu, 0x8c0000b0 + i, 0x8c000040 + i);
124
125 /* ... which contains only 1 instruction, a special
126 opcode which triggers PROM emulation: */
127 store_16bit_word(cpu, 0x8c000040 + i, SH_INVALID_INSTR);
128 }
129
130 /* PROM reboot, in case someone jumps to 0xa0000000: */
131 store_16bit_word(cpu, 0xa0000000, SH_INVALID_INSTR);
132
133 dreamcast_romfont_init(machine);
134 }
135
136
137 /*
138 * dreamcast_emul():
139 */
140 int dreamcast_emul(struct cpu *cpu)
141 {
142 int addr = (cpu->pc & 0xff) - 0x40 + 0xb0;
143 int r1 = cpu->cd.sh.r[1];
144 int r6 = cpu->cd.sh.r[6];
145 int r7 = cpu->cd.sh.r[7];
146
147 /* Special case: Reboot */
148 if ((uint32_t)cpu->pc == 0xa0000000) {
149 fatal("[ dreamcast reboot ]\n");
150 cpu->running = 0;
151 return 1;
152 }
153
154 switch (addr) {
155
156 case 0xb0:
157 /* SYSINFO */
158 switch (r7) {
159 default:fatal("[ SYSINFO: Unimplemented r7=%i ]\n", r7);
160 goto bad;
161 }
162 break;
163
164 case 0xb4:
165 /* ROMFONT */
166 switch (r1) {
167 case 0: /* ROMFONT_ADDRESS */
168 cpu->cd.sh.r[0] = DREAMCAST_ROMFONT_BASE;
169 break;
170 default:fatal("[ ROMFONT: Unimplemented r1=%i ]\n", r1);
171 goto bad;
172 }
173 break;
174
175 case 0xb8:
176 /* FLASHROM */
177 switch (r7) {
178 case 0: /* FLASHROM_INFO */
179 /* TODO */
180 cpu->cd.sh.r[0] = (uint32_t) -1;
181 break;
182 default:fatal("[ FLASHROM: Unimplemented r7=%i ]\n", r7);
183 goto bad;
184 }
185 break;
186
187 case 0xbc:
188 switch ((int32_t)r6) {
189 case 0: /* GD-ROM emulation */
190 switch (r7) {
191 case 0: /* GDROM_SEND_COMMAND */
192 /* TODO */
193 cpu->cd.sh.r[0] = (uint32_t) -1;
194 break;
195 case 1: /* GDROM_CHECK_COMMAND */
196 /* TODO */
197 cpu->cd.sh.r[0] = 0;
198 break;
199 case 2: /* GDROM_MAINLOOP */
200 /* TODO */
201 break;
202 case 3: /* GDROM_INIT */
203 /* TODO: Do something here? */
204 break;
205 case 4: /* GDROM_CHECK_DRIVE */
206 /* TODO: Return status words */
207 break;
208 default:fatal("[ GDROM: Unimplemented r7=%i ]\n", r7);
209 goto bad;
210 }
211 break;
212 default:fatal("[ 0xbc: Unimplemented r6=0x%x ]\n", r6);
213 goto bad;
214 }
215 break;
216
217 case 0xe0:
218 /*
219 * This seems to have two uses:
220 *
221 * 1. KalistOS calls this from arch_menu(), i.e. to return
222 * from a running program.
223 * 2. The "licence code" in the IP.BIN code when booting from
224 * a bootable CD image calls this once the license screen
225 * has been displayed, and it wants the ROM to jump to
226 * 0x8c00b800 ("Bootstrap 1").
227 *
228 * The easiest way to support both is probably to keep track
229 * of whether the IP.BIN code was started by the (software)
230 * ROM emulation code, or not.
231 */
232 if (booting_from_cdrom) {
233 fatal("[ dreamcast: Switching to bootstrap 1 ]\n");
234 booting_from_cdrom = 0;
235 cpu->pc = 0x8c00b800;
236 return 1;
237 } else {
238 fatal("[ dreamcast: Returning to main menu. ]\n");
239 cpu->running = 0;
240 }
241 break;
242
243 case 0xf0:
244 /*
245 * GXemul hack:
246 *
247 * By jumping to this address (0x8c000080), a "boot from
248 * CDROM" is simulated. Control is transfered to the license
249 * code in the loaded IP.BIN file.
250 */
251 debug("[ dreamcast boot from CDROM ]\n");
252 booting_from_cdrom = 1;
253 cpu->pc = 0x8c008300;
254 return 1;
255
256 default:goto bad;
257 }
258
259 /* Return from subroutine: */
260 cpu->pc = cpu->cd.sh.pr;
261
262 return 1;
263
264 bad:
265 cpu_register_dump(cpu->machine, cpu, 1, 0);
266 printf("\n");
267 fatal("[ dreamcast_emul(): unimplemented dreamcast PROM call, "
268 "pc=0x%08"PRIx32" ]\n", (uint32_t)cpu->pc);
269 cpu->running = 0;
270 return 1;
271 }
272
